Dormer flashing repair services focus on fixing the protective barriers installed around dormer windows to prevent water intrusion. These flashings are typically made of metal or other durable materials and are designed to seal the junctions where the dormer meets the roof.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ause these flashings to deteriorate, crack, or become loose, leading to potential leaks. Professional contractors specializing in dormer flashing repair can inspect the condition of these barriers and perform necessary repairs to restore their effectiveness, helping to preserve the integrity of the roof and prevent costly water damage.

Many problems can stem from faulty dormer flashings, including water leaks inside the attic or upper floors, mold growth, wood rot, and damage to interior ceilings and walls. When flashings fail, rainwater can seep into the gaps, causing ongoing moisture issues that compromise the structure of the home. Addressing these issues early with proper repairs can prevent more extensive and expensive repairs down the line. Service providers experienced in dormer flashing repair use specialized techniques and materials to ensure the flashings are properly sealed, durable, and capable of withstanding the local weather conditions.

The overview below groups typical Dormer Flashing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Corvallis, OR.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or dormer flashing repairs in Corvallis range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, covering common issues like sealant replacement or small leaks.

Moderate Repairs - More extensive repairs, such as replacing sections of flashing or addressing multiple problem areas, usually cost between $600-$1,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to restore proper drainage and protection.

Full Replacement - Complete dormer flashing replacement can range from $1,500-$3,500, dep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ger, more complex jobs are less frequent but may reach higher costs for custom or detailed work.

Major Projects - Large-scale or custom dormer flashing repairs and replacements can exceed $3,500, with some complex projects reaching $5,000 or more. These are typically less common and involve extensive work or unique architectural features.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are dormer flashing repairs? Dormer flashing repairs involve fixing or replacing the metal or waterproof barriers around dormer windows to prevent leaks and water damage.

Why is flashing important for dormers? Proper flashing helps direct water away from the roof and dormer structure, protecting the home from potential water intrusion and related issues.

How do I know if my dormer flashing needs repair? Signs include water stains on ceilings, peeling paint near the dormer, or visible rust and corrosion on the flashing materials.

What types of materials are used for dormer flashing? Common materials include aluminum, copper, or galvanized steel, chosen for durability and weather resistance.
